    Well, the directory is transferred using http, which means that endpoint must join the tms on http or https in order to get it. An alternative would be to open port 80 or 443 so that MSDS are available on the public internet, which is what you eventually to do. If you use a double tms pointing to the same database where a single server is public you anyway compromising server tms to the public internet from the info you get would be the same no matter which tms server you connect to because of the shared db. The c20s must be added in tms as well (but not accessible by the MSDS if it is a system of soho) in order to obtain the authorization to access the directories that you set on the system. But there is no need to be very complex, as long as the endpoints can reach the tms of the internet server.

    Hello Zhang,

    The native for Ex90 recording medium and many other points of video endpoints began with CUCM 8.6 and later versions. Then you can try to register but will not be a native SIP registration.

    You can try the steps below to check.

    1 create a SIP digest user and associate it with the third sip.

    2. Add endpoint third-party SIP device (advance).

    3. set the required field device pool, location, line (Partition & CSS), SIP profile, device security profile.

    If the above does not work, and if you are looking for just call aim you can navigate with the third SIP (BASIC).

    Hi Alex

    In the management of directories if you click on a directory there are Access tab control that allows you to assign access to directories for users.

    Then you must make sure that you the directory server URI in the configuration of the user model commissioning as [email protected] / * / .

    Make sure then that the TMS and the VCS is synchronized, you should now be able to search for directories if everything is correct.
